Output 676064f6cd916218debd8bc3177304916295cede2e64cce2ea6b7b77acbf9d44:1

value
2407289
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 722a4ac665201bc1c2ad6cf7cb709189e84d17bd OP_EQUALVERIFY OP_CHECKSIG
address
1BQehNj68HveS3vD5xVxWHRNmVuz3inGDF
transaction
676064f6cd916218debd8bc3177304916295cede2e64cce2ea6b7b77acbf9d44
confirmations
212205
spent
true